Plenty of Sheffield Wednesday fans have taken to Twitter to react to the club's decision to loan out Joost van Aken to VfL Osnabruck.

As confirmed by the Owls' official website, the 25-year-old will spend the rest of the 2019/20 campaign in Germany's second division with the Lily Whites.

Despite making a positive initial impression for Wednesday following his move from Heerenveen in 2017, van Aken soon fell out of favour at Hillsborough and was limited to just two appearances in all competitions during the previous campaign due to the form illustrated by the likes of Michael Hector and Tom Lees.

Having failed to make the match-day squad for either of the Owls' Championship fixtures this season, the Dutchman will be aiming to finally tie down some regular first team football for VfL Osnabruck.

The defender's departure from South Yorkshire takes Wednesday's tally in terms of outgoings this summer to 11.

Van Aken could make his debut for his new side when they face SV Darmstadt 98 in the 2.Bundesliga on Monday.
